Before you begin:
1. Disable locks and remove any ropes connected to the garage
door.
2. Lift the door halfway up. Release the door. If balanced, it should
stay in place, supported entirely by its springs.
3. Raise and lower the door to check for binding or sticking. If
your door binds, sticks, or is out of balance, call a trained door
systems technician.
4. Check the seal on the bottom of the door. Any gap between the
floor and the bottom of the door must not exceed 1/4" (6 mm).
Otherwise, the safety reversal system may not work properly.
5. The opener should be installed above the center of the door. If
there is a torsion spring or center bearing plate in the way of the
header bracket, it may be installed within 4feet (1.2 m) to the
left or right of the door center. See page 11.

IMPORTANT INFORMATION ABOUT THE SAFETY REVERSING SENSORS
The safety reversing sensors must be connected and aligned correctly before the
garage door opener will move in the down direction.
The sending sensor (with an amber LED) transmits an invisible light beam to the
receiving sensor (with a green LED). If an obstruction breaks the light beam while the
door is closing, the door will stop and reverse to the full open position, and the garage
door opener lights will flash 10 times.
NOTE: For energy efficiency the garage door opener will enter sleep mode when the door
is fully closed. The sleep mode shuts the garage door opener down until activated. The
sleep mode is sequenced with the garage door opener lights; as the lights turns off, the
sensor LEDs will turn off and whenever the garage door opener lights turn on, the sensor
LEDs will light. The garage door opener will not go into the sleep mode until the garage
door opener has completed 5 cycles upon power up.
When installing the safety reversing sensors check the following:
l Sensors are installed inside the garage, one on either side of the door.
l Sensors are facing each other with the lenses aligned and the receiving sensor
lens does not receive direct sunlight.
l Sensors are no more than 6 inches (15 cm) above the floor and the light beam is
unobstructed.

3 Charge the Battery*
The battery charges when the garage door opener is plugged into a 120Vac electrical
outlet that has power and requires 24 hours to fully charge. A fully charged battery
supplies 12Vdc to the garage door opener for one to two days of normal operation
during an electrical power outage. After the electrical power has been restored, the
battery will recharge within 24 hours. The battery will last approximately 1 to 2 years with
normal usage. Instructions for replacement are provided with the battery. To obtain
maximum battery life and prevent damage, disconnect the battery when the garage door
opener is unplugged for an extended period of time, such as a summer or winter home.
NOTE: When the garage door opener is in battery backup mode the garage door opener
lights, Timer-to-Close, and Remote Close features are unavailable.
In battery backup mode, the Automatic Garage Door Lock will unlock when the garage
door is opened, and will remain disabled until power is restored.

Features
Your garage door opener is equipped with features to provide you with greater control
over your garage door operation.
Alert2Close
The Alert2Close feature provides a visual and an audible alert that an unattended door is
closing.
TIMER-TO-CLOSE (TTC)
The TTC feature automatically closes the door after a specified time period that can be
adjusted using a TTC enabled door control (Models 881LMW or 880LMW). Prior to and
during the door closing the garage door opener lights will flash and the garage door
opener will beep.
myQ
myQ allows you to control your garage door opener from your mobile device or computer
from anywhere. myQ technology uses a 900Mhz signal to provide two way
communication between the garage door opener and myQ enabled accessories.
The garage door opener has an internal gateway that allows the garage door opener to
communicate directly with a home Wi-Fi®network and access your myQ account.
THE PROTECTOR SYSTEM®(SAFETY REVERSING SENSORS)
When properly connected and aligned, the safety reversing sensors will detect an
obstruction in the path of the infrared beam. If an obstruction breaks the infrared beam
while the door is closing, the door will stop and reverse to full open position, and the
opener lights will flash 10 times. If the door is fully open, and the safety reversing
sensors are not installed, or are misaligned, the door will not close from a remote control.
However, you can close the door if you hold the button on the door control or keyless
entry until the door is fully closed. The safety reversing sensors do not affect the
opening cycle. For more information see page 22.
ENERGY CONSERVATION
For energy efficiency the garage door opener will enter sleep mode when the door is fully
closed. The sleep mode shuts the garage door opener down until activated. The sleep
mode is sequenced with the garage door opener light bulb; as the light bulb turns off the
sensor LEDs will turn off and whenever the garage door opener lights turn on the sensor
LEDs will light. The garage door opener will not go into the sleep mode until the garage
door opener has completed 5 cycles upon power up.
LIGHTS
The garage door opener light bulbs will turn on when the opener is initially plugged in;
power is restored after interruption, or when the garage door opener is activated. The
lights will turn off automatically after 4-1/2 minutes. An incandescent A19 light bulb
(100 watt maximum) or for maximum energy efficiency a 26W (100W equivalent)
compact fluorescent light (CFL) bulb may be used.
Light Feature
The garage door opener is equipped with an added feature; the lights will turn on when
someone enters through the open garage door and the safety reversing sensor infrared
beam is broken. For added control over the light bulbs on your garage door opener, see
page 37.
AUTOMATIC GARAGE DOOR LOCK*
Garage door opener models featuring the Security Shield are compatible with
the LiftMaster Automatic Garage Door Lock (Model 841LM). See Accessories,
page43.
* If applicable.
USING YOUR GARAGE DOOR OPENER
The garage door opener can be activated through a wall-mounted door control, remote
control, wireless keyless entry or myQ accessory. When the door is closed and the
garage door opener is activated the door will open. If the door senses an obstruction or
is interrupted while opening the door will stop. When the door is in any position other
than closed and the garage door opener is activated the door will close. If the garage
door opener senses an obstruction while closing, the door will reverse. If the obstruction
interrupts the sensor beam the garage door opener lights will blink 10 times. However,
you can close the door if you hold the button on the door control or keyless entry until
the door is fully closed. The safety reversing sensors do not affect the opening cycle.
The safety reversing sensor must be connected and aligned correctly before the garage
door opener will move in the down direction.
BATTERY BACKUP*
The battery backup system allows access in and out of your garage, even when the
power is out. When the garage door opener is operating on battery power, the garage
door opener will run slower, the light will not function, the Battery Status LED will glow
solid orange, and a beep will sound approximately every 2 seconds.

Maintenance
Maintenance Schedule
EVERY MONTH
l Manually operate door. If it is unbalanced or binding, call a trained door systems
technician.
l Check to be sure door opens and closes fully. Adjust if necessary, see page 29.
l Test the safety reversal system. Adjust if necessary, see page 30.
EVERY YEAR
l Oil door rollers, bearings and hinges. The garage door opener does not require
additional lubrication. Do not grease the door tracks.
l Test the battery and consider replacing the battery to ensure the garage door
opener will operate during an electrical power outage, see page 31 to test the
battery backup.
EVERY TWO TO THREE YEARS
l Use a rag to wipe away the existing grease from the garage door opener rail.
Reapply a small layer of white lithium grease to the top and underside of the rail
surface where the trolley slides.
